About 2-[(5-bromo-2-oxo-1H-indol-3-ylidene)hydrazinylidene]-5-[(4-fluorophenyl)methylidene]-3-(3-propan-2-ylphenyl)-1,3-thiazolidin-4-one
2-[(5-bromo-2-oxo-1H-indol-3-ylidene)hydrazinylidene]-5-[(4-fluorophenyl)methylidene]-3-(3-propan-2-ylphenyl)-1,3-thiazolidin-4-one (PubChem CID 175375354) has the molecular formula C27H20BrFN4O2S
and a molecular weight of 563.45 g/mol. Its IUPAC name is 2-[(5-bromo-2-oxo-1H-indol-3-ylidene)hydrazinylidene]-5-[(4-fluorophenyl)methylidene]-3-(3-propan-2-ylphenyl)-1,3-thiazolidin-4-one.
